Paul Stanley Current Age and Personal Details

Paul Stanley, born Stanley Bert Eisen on January 20, 1952, is currently 73 years old. He is an American musician, singer, songwriter, and painter best known as the rhythm guitarist and co-lead vocalist of the hard rock band Kiss. Stanley co-founded Kiss in 1973 in New York City alongside Gene Simmons, Ace Frehley, and Peter Criss. He has remained a core member of the band throughout its history, performing under the stage name "The Starchild." Early Life and Background

Stanley grew up in Queens, New York, and later in Freeport, Long Island. He formed his first band in the late 1960s before meeting Gene Simmons, with whom he built the foundation for Kiss. His role in the band as "The Starchild" became central to Kiss's visual identity and stage theatrics. Biography.com confirms his birth date and early career milestones.

Paul Stanley Career Highlights and Band Legacy

Kiss released 20 studio albums, with Paul Stanley writing or co-writing many of the band's biggest hits, including "Detroit Rock City," "Rock and Roll All Nite," and "I Was Made for Lovin' You." The band has sold over 100 million records worldwide, making it one of the best-selling American hard rock acts. Stanley's vocal range and showmanship helped define the band's sound and live performance style. Rolling Stone notes Kiss's induction into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ame.

Solo Work and Other Projects

Outside of Kiss, Stanley has released solo albums and toured under his own name. He is also a painter and has exhibited his artwork publicly. His solo work maintains the hard rock style associated with Kiss while showcasing his range as a musician. AllMusic tracks his solo discography and credits.

Paul Stanley Recent Activities and Net Worth

In recent years, Stanley has continued to tour with Kiss, including the band's final tour, "End of the Road World Tour," which concluded in 2023. He has also focused on his art and personal projects while maintaining involvement in the band's legacy and business. Billboard covered the final tour dates and financial impact.
